Cambridge-South Dorchester High School Cambridge-South Dorchester High School is located in Cambridge, Maryland, is part of the Dorchester County Public Schools system, and serves students in grades 9 to 12. The school opened in 1976 and cost $9 million to build and equip (...) Harriet Tubman Memorial Garden The Harriet Tubman Memorial Garden is part of the Harriet Tubman Underground Railroad Byway (Maryland) and is located in Cambridge, Maryland. It honours the life of abolitionist Harriet Tubman and the journeys of the many people she assisted to escape slavery (...) Cambridge, Maryland Cambridge is a city in Dorchester County, Maryland, United States. The population was 12,326 at the 2010 census. It is the county seat of Dorchester County and the county's largest municipality. Cambridge is the fourth most populous city in Maryland's Eastern Shore region, after Salisbury, Elkton (...) Sycamore Cottage Sycamore Cottage is a historic home located at Cambridge, Dorchester County, Maryland, United States. It was built possibly as early as 1765. The house is a -story gambrel-roofed frame structure. Remodelings during the 19th century include adding Victorian windows, a central Colonial Revival (...) |
